Hi.
Im quite new att flightsim so Im not sure if this is right or not.
When Im in level flight with the 727-100 i hav about 6-8 degres nose up attitude.
Is this supposed to be or am I doing something wrong.

Your pitch attitude depends on your weight, speed and flap deployment.  The slower you go, and the heavier the airplane, the more nose up you will be in level flight until you start setting your flaps out.  There are minumum speeds you should not go below for each flap setting that will result in reasonable attitudes -- I am not sure if these are in the Captain Sim manuals or not.

By way of some further information, the most pitch you would see in level flight would be about 7-8 degrees in level flight with flaps five at the minimum maneuver speed for your weight or 6-7 degrees with flaps 15 at the minimum maneuver speed with that configuration.

Not counting spped or flaps...say at cruise speed, theres a huge difference in attitude if you have fuel full tanks 100%, or just 50%.
Try it, go to "Fuel and Payload" and change the three tanks from 100 to 50. You´ll see the nose going down and the plane levelled.
